Heading : Six Georgian facet cut stem short wine or port glass
Period : George III. c1780
Origin : England
Colour : Clear. grey-blue hue
Bowl : Conical bowl engraved with Tulips and olives ( also known as egg and dart)
Stem : Graduated hexagonal cut facets
Foot : Conical
Pontil : Snapped
Glass Type : Lead
Size : 12.7cm height. 5.7cm diameter bowl. 6.6cm diameter foot
Condition : No chips or cracks. One foot have a trail of glass beneath the foot from manufacture
Restoration : None
Weight: 620grams
